Biography
Gilette Barbier was a French actress known for her extensive work in film and television. She appeared in notable films such as Out 1: Spectre (1972), directed by Jacques Rivette, and The Favour, the Watch and the Very Big Fish (1991). Barbier was married to actor Raymond Jourdan.
